What is Riddhi Display Equipments PEG Ratio?

PE Ratio without NRI / 5-Year EBITDA Growth Rate*

PEG Ratio is defined as the PE Ratio without NRI divided by the growth ratio. The growth rate we use is the 5-Year EBITDA growth rate. As of today, Riddhi Display Equipments's PE Ratio without NRI is 6.52. Riddhi Display Equipments's 5-Year EBITDA growth rate is 0.00%. Therefore, Riddhi Display Equipments's PEG Ratio for today is N/A.

* The 5-Year EBITDA Growth Rate is the 5-year average EBITDA per share growth rate. While the denominator is a percentage, we use the whole number as opposed to the decimal form for the calculation. For example, 5% would be shown as 5 as opposed to 0.05. If it's smaller than or equal to 0, then the PEG Ratio is not calculated.

Riddhi Display Equipments  (BOM:544640) PEG Ratio Explanation

To compare stocks with different growth rates, Peter Lynch invented a ratio called PEG Ratio. PEG Ratio is defined as the P/E ratio divided by the growth ratio. He thinks a company with a P/E ratio equal to its growth rate is fairly valued. Still he said he would rather buy a company growing 20% a year with a P/E of 20, instead of a company growing 10% a year with a P/E of 10.

Riddhi Display Equipments Business Description

Address National Highway-27 Gondal Highway, Plot No.1, Survey No.2/1 P4/P2, Village Bhojpara, Gondal, Rajkot, GJ, IND, 360311
Riddhi Display Equipments Ltd is engaged in the business of manufacturing and supply of Display Counter, Kitchen Equipments and Refrigeration Equipments. It is engaged in creating inventive and tailormade solutions for commercial kitchen and bakery setup requirements. The Company offers customized display equipment for Sweet, Bakery, Namkeen, Fast-food, Chat, Dry Fruit, Snacks, Panipuri (Gol Gappa), Sweet Corn, Ice-cream and Shrikhand. The products manufacture by the company are supplied to Restaurants, Food Courts, Cafes, Retail Shops, Super Markets, Ice Cream Parlours, Cake & Pastry Shops, etc.
